The annual Amarnath Yatra resumed from Jammu on Saturday (July 25, 2026) after remaining suspended for six days due to inclement weather, with a fresh batch of over 6,000 pilgrims leaving the Bhagwati Nagar base camp for Baltal base camp in Kashmir Valley, officials said.On July 19, the yatra was suspended as a precautionary measure following persistent rainfall and adverse weather conditions across Jammu and Kashmir, especially along the twin routes — traditional 48-km Pahalgam route in Anantnag district and the shorter 14-km Baltal route in Ganderbal district — to the 3,880-metre-high holy cave shrine.
